Tobacco
A plant whose leaves are harvested and processed for smoking, chewing, or snuffing, containing the addictive substance nicotine.
Alcohol
A chemical compound, specifically ethanol in the context of beverages, which is consumed and can alter consciousness or behavior.
Fet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orders
The continuum of physical, mental, and behavioral outcomes caused by prenatal exposure to alcohol.
Thalidomide
A drug initially used for morning sickness in the late 1950s and early 1960s, later found to cause birth defects, leading to greater drug regulation and safety measures.
